One common challenge faced by mechanics is the faint or worn-out timing chain marks on older engines. Over time, the marks may become blurred or almost invisible, making it difficult to determine their exact position. In such cases, using an inspection mirror or a digital camera with a close-up lens can help magnify and capture the marks, aiding in their identification. Additionally, referencing the vehicle’s service manual specific to its make and model is crucial, providing guidance on the alignment procedure and offering detailed diagrams of the timing marks for precise adjustments.

  • Using timing chain alignment tools: These specialized tools provide a visual aid for aligning the marks accurately, reducing the risk of errors.
  • Applying white paint or chalk: In cases where the marks are difficult to see, carefully applying white paint or chalk can make them more visible.
  • Replacing worn timing chain components: If the marks are consistently hard to align due to excessive wear or stretching of the timing chain, replacing these components may be necessary for improved accuracy.

Q: What are the consequences of incorrect timing chain alignment?
A: Incorrect timing chain alignment can have severe consequences for your engine. It can lead to poor performance, decreased fuel efficiency, misfires, and potentially cause damage to engine components such as valves, pistons, or the timing chain itself.

Q: Are there any precautions I should take before aligning the timing chain marks?
A: Before attempting to align the timing chain marks, ensure that the engine is completely cooled down to prevent any potential burns. It is also crucial to disconnect the battery to avoid accidental engagement of the starter motor. Always refer to the appropriate safety guidelines and follow the instructions provided in your vehicle’s service manual.
